The legal framework against film piracy in India has been significantly strengthened. Under the Cinematograph (Amendment) Act, 2023 , unauthorized recording and transmission of films are strictly prohibited, with violations now attracting severe penalties. Offenders can face a minimum of three months in prison, which can extend up to three years . Furthermore, the financial penalties are substantial, with fines starting at ₹3 lakh and potentially reaching up to 5% of the film's audited gross production cost . While there has been legal debate about whether merely watching a pirated movie online constitutes an offense, downloading, sharing, or distributing such content is undeniably illegal and can lead to prosecution.
